OperationοΌ β Open the battery cover and put one battery in. β Control of the polar as battery(+&-) β Press On/Off button to see if the LED is on β 1-6 channel be set by rotary switch which are marked on the rotary dial of each device, set the switch channel same as the receiverβs channel. Circuit description: About the Circuit, the 315MHz crystal can generate the 315MHz signal. Then the signal will be transferred through the coding chip (HS2262A), which can code the signal. The gear switch on the chip can be switched for 6 kinds of codes, which are called β6 channels β. Then the coding signal can be transmitted to the collector of the triode, and then transmit to the space through an internal antenna. The triode also amplifies the signal. The power of the circuit is controlled by a manual button.

No.6, Tongtu RD., Jiangdong District, Ningbo City, China EUT Description NINGBO ALL-RF ELECTRONIC CO., LTD Model number 2022 (referred to as the EUT in this test report) is a transmitter part of Remote Control Switch. The transmitter is manually operated and has a button. It also has a gear selector which can select from 6 codes. When gear selector of the receiver of power switch is adjusted corresponding with the transmitter, the remote control will be accomplished. The codes donβt influence the RF characteristics.
